Police Makes $100 Million Illegal Gambling Bust

7 February 2005

NEW YORK – As reported by the New York Newsday: "In what prosecutors described as a $100-million-dollar bust of organized crime, 12 people in four boroughs were arrested over the weekend for allegedly running an illegal gambling network that included bets on the Super Bowl.

"Dubbed Operation Kings Flush, the month-long sting ended with raids of nine locations in Brooklyn, Queens, Manhattan and Staten Island, officials said.

"The 12 bookies took bets from neighborhood betting parlors, funneling the bulk of the proceeds to established organized-crime families, including the Gambino and Genovese rings, Brooklyn District Attorney Charles Hynes said. Hynes' office, the Staten Island's district attorney's office and the NYPD worked together on the operation.

"…Bets were taken for professional basketball, football and college basketball games, Hynes said, with the Super Bowl the biggest cash cow…"
